About This Book
Feel the warm breeze on your face as the colorful hot-air balloon lifts off into the bright blue sky. Below, the lush green rice paddies stretch like a giant quilt across Vietnam’s countryside. This magical ride brings you close to the sights, sounds, and stories of a faraway land full of wonder.

Quick Assessment
This early-reader book introduces young children to Vietnam through an imaginative hot-air balloon journey. It provides a gentle and sensory-rich exploration of the country’s geography and culture, suitable for ages 5 to 8. The content is straightforward, with no conflict or mature themes, making it ideal for early nonfiction learners.
